⛰️declivity

noun
/dɪˈklɪvɪti/

Meaning

a downward slope of ground

Example Sentences

They carefully climbed down the declivity of the hill.

Synonyms

slope, incline, descent, downhill

Antonyms

ascent, rise

Collocations

steep declivity, rocky declivity, natural declivity, gentle declivity
